Situated between the Inland Empire and the Coachella Valley in the San Gorgonio Pass, Banning is a small town with stunning vistas of the two tallest peaks in southern California—Mount San Jacinto and Mount San Gorgonio. The Gilman Ranch Museum displays Banning’s rich history, which contributes to its modern-day spirit of pioneer ingenuity.
A bevy of local events brings the community together in Banning, including the popular Stagecoach Days, Thunder and Lightning Pow Wow, Concerts in the Park, and more. Convenience to numerous parks, hot springs, and casinos ensures there is always something to do near Banning as well. Getting around from Banning is easy with access to I-10 and I-215 in addition to Routes 60 and 79.
